原文:iOS中都有什么设计模式?各个设计模式的作用?

一 iOS中都有什么设计模式 .代理模式 .观察者模式 .MVC模式 .单例模式 .策略模式 .工厂模式 二 各个设计模式的作用 一 代理模式 在观察者模式中,一个对象任何状态的变更都会通知另外的对改变感兴趣的对象。这些对象之间不需要知道彼此的存在,这其实是一种松耦合的设计。当某个属性变化的时候,我们通常使用这个模式去通知其它对象。 此模式的通用实现中,观察者注册自己感兴趣的其它对象的状态变更事件 ...

2016-05-10 19:56 0 20334 推荐指数:

查看详情

iOS设计模式 - 单例

iOS设计模式 - 单例 原理图 源码 https://github.com/YouXianMing/iOS-Design-Patterns ...

Fri Aug 07 05:18:00 CST 2015 6 1223
iOS设计模式 —— KVC

刨根问底KVC KVC 全称 key valued coding 键值编码 反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法和属性.JAVA,C#都有这个机制。ObjC也有,所以你根部不必进行任何操作就可以 ...

Sat Oct 08 19:35:00 CST 2016 0 1918
iOS设计模式 - 命令

iOS设计模式 - 命令 原理图 说明 命令对象封装了如何对目标执行指令的信息,因此客户端或调用者不必了解目标的任何细节,却仍可以对他执行任何已有的操作。通过把请求封装成对象,客户端可以把它参数化并置入队列或日志中,也能够支持可撤销操作。命令对象将一个或多个动作绑定到特定 ...

Sun Oct 18 06:05:00 CST 2015 5 1633
iOS设计模式汇总

Ios 设计模式,你可能听说过,但是你真正知道这是什么意思么?大部分的开发者大概都同意设计模式很重要,但是关于这一部分却没有很多的文章去介绍它,我们开发者很多时候写代码的时候也并不重视设计模式. 设计模式是在软件设计上去解决普通问题的可重用的方法.他们是是帮助你让所写的代码更加容易理解和提高 ...

Wed Aug 26 19:14:00 CST 2015 0 3720
开发中都用到了那些设计模式?用在什么场合?

所谓设计模式,就是一套被反复使用的代码设计经验的总结(情境中一个问题经过证实的一个解决方案)。使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性。设计模式使人们可以更加简单方便的复用成功的设计和体系结构。将已证实的技术表述成设计模式也会使新系统开发者更加容易理解其设计思路 ...

Thu Sep 06 23:50:00 CST 2018 0 2932
Spring 框架中都用到了哪些设计模式

Spring 框架中都用到了哪些设计模式? Spring 框架中使用到了大量的设计模式,下面列举了比较有代表性的: 1、代理模式—在 AOP 和 remoting 中被用的比较多。 2、单例模式:在 spring 配置文件中定义的 bean 默认为单例模式。 3、模板模式 ...

Sat Nov 16 19:14:00 CST 2019 0 487
谈谈Spring中都用到了哪些设计模式

谈谈Spring中都用到了哪些设计模式? JDK 中用到了那些设计模式?Spring 中用到了那些设计模式?这两个问题,在面试中比较常见。我在网上搜索了一下关于 Spring 中设计模式的讲解几乎都是千篇一律,而且大部分都年代久远。所以,花了几天时间自己总结了一下,由于我的个人能力有限,文中如有 ...

Tue Feb 18 18:07:00 CST 2020 0 3718
IOS设计模式-组合设计模式

)    在介绍组合设计模式之前,有必要先简单讲讲树形结构,百度一下"树形结构",你很容易找到关于树形结构的 ...

Mon Feb 29 07:41:00 CST 2016 0 2226
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M